Only Boo! - Season 1

Season 1
Only Boo! is a story of Moo, a high school boy who dreams of debuting as a boyband artist. One day, Moo gets transferred to a new school where fate leads him to a rice and curry seller named Kang, whose kindness leaves him with an impression that slowly turns into affection. Being bold as Moo is, he makes a move on Kang. Moo puts his all into pursuing Kang while constantly practicing singing and dancing. Finally, he gets a chance to debut, but his record label has an ironclad rule prohibiting artists from dating!
Episodes

Change
Moo's mother forces him to move to a rural town to remove the distractions of his aspirations of becoming an idol. Upon arriving, Moo meets Kang, a kind guy who helps him adjust to his new life.

The Kind One
At school, Moo meets Potae and Payos, who also dream of being in a dance group. Racking up quite a debt with Kang, Moo begins helping out at the food stall.

Episode 3
Moo shares how he feels with Kang but Kang is worried that by spending too much time with Moo, Moo will not have the chance to make friends at school.

Episode 4
Moo takes Shone's advice on how to win Kang's heart.

Episode 5
Moo prepares a special gesture for Kang, but is ultimately punished by the school director. Kang worries that Moo's crush is distracting him from his school work and responsibilities.

Episode 6
After improving his grades, Moo seeks permission from his mother to continue with his audition.

Episode 7
Moo, Potae, and Payos attend their audition.

Episode 8
Potae, Payos, and Moo get a second chance to audition as a group.

Episode 9
Moo begins training and competing to debut. Shone cautions Moo not to go public about his relationship with Kang as it could affect is prospects.

Episode 10
Moo's agency asks all their trainees to sign a contract agreeing they will not date anyone.

Episode 11
A year passes without contact between Kang and Moo.

Episode 12
After a year apart, Moo speaks to Kang and his company about his desire to maintain his personal relationship and his career.
